In 1926, Eleanor Jane Bowles entered the world in Carrollton, Carroll County, Missouri, United States of America, born to Bowles And Nellie Jane Tickle. In 1930, Eleanor Jane Bowles resided in Montgomery, Montgomery, Missouri, USA. In 1935, Eleanor Jane Bowles resided in Macon, Missouri. Eleanor Jane Bowles married Frank Clark Griffith. Eleanor Jane Bowles passed away in 2000 in Excelsior Springs, Clay County, Missouri, United States of America.
